Message type: E = Error
Message class: RSCV - Analysis of BW objects (InfoCubes...)
Message number: 500
Message text: Table &1 is analyzed

- Table &1 is analyzed ?The SAP error message RSCV500 indicates that a specific table (denoted as &1) is currently being analyzed. This message typically arises in the context of data extraction or reporting processes, particularly when using SAP BW (Business Warehouse) or similar data management tools.
Cause: The error message RSCV500 is usually triggered when: A data extraction or reporting process is attempting to access a table that is currently undergoing analysis or is locked for some reason. The table may be in a state of being updated, or a background job is running that is analyzing the data in that table. There may be a long-running process that is holding a lock on the table, preventing other processes from accessing it.
